7. Digital content and cancellation rights

Some of our products are digital content supplied immediately after purchase.

Where required by law, before accessing an immediate digital download or digital product, you may be asked to confirm that:

  • you agree to receive the digital content immediately; and

  • you understand that you may lose your 14-day right to cancel once access or download begins.

For UK consumers, GOV.UK explains that businesses supplying downloads or streaming services must get the customer’s agreement to instant access and acknowledgement that they lose the 14-day right to cancel once the download or access starts.

This does not affect your statutory rights if the digital content is faulty, not as described, or not provided with reasonable care.
